DEMIRE Deutsche Mittelstand Real Estate (DMRE) Q1 2026 earnings summary
Event summary combining transcript, slides, and related documents.
Q1 2026 earnings summary
15 May, 2026Executive summary
Rental income and FFO I declined year-over-year due to planned property disposals and a weak economic environment, but results were in line with expectations.
Annualised contractual rent as of 31 March 2026 was EUR 45.7 million, down from EUR 51.3 million at year-end 2025, mainly due to disposals and increased vacancy.
Letting performance dropped to 2,700 sq m, down from 25,000+ sq m in Q1 2025, with expectations for improvement by year-end.
Management streamlined, reducing the board from three to two members, with responsibilities reallocated.
Two properties (Flensburg and Bonn) sold for EUR 17.5 million; proceeds used to pay down loans.
Portfolio highlights
Annualised contractual rent declined from EUR 56.4 million in FY 2025 to EUR 45.7 million in Q1 2026, mainly due to asset disposals and higher vacancy.
Letting performance fell from 25,530 sq m in Q1 2025 to 2,710 sq m in Q1 2026, with expectations for larger lettings later in the year.
EPRA vacancy increased from 16.4% at FY 2025 to 21.0% in Q1 2026, primarily due to two assets becoming fully vacant.
WALT improved from 4.7 years to 5.2 years, reflecting lease structure changes.
Financial highlights
Rental income for Q1 2026 was EUR 11.6 million, down 17.3% year-over-year, mainly due to prior year disposals.
FFO I was EUR 0.3 million, down 85.7% year-over-year, reflecting lower rental income.
EBIT improved to EUR 2.7 million from a loss of EUR 3.4 million in Q1 2025, as no material devaluations occurred.
Net loss for the period was EUR -8.6 million, improved from EUR -15.5 million year-over-year.
Balance sheet total reduced from EUR 849 million to EUR 833 million, reflecting disposals and negative period result.
Equity attributable to shareholders declined by 6.8% to EUR 120.4 million, reflecting negative profit for the period.
NAV per share (basic) decreased to EUR 1.48 (year-end 2025: EUR 1.59).
